What is the primary role of budgeting in personal finance?

The primary role of budgeting in personal finance is to track income and manage spending effectively. Budgeting allows individuals to create a financial plan that outlines their income, expenses, and savings goals. By systematically recording their income, individuals can have a clear view of their financial situation. This clarity helps in prioritizing spending and ensures that essential expenses are covered while also allowing for savings and discretionary spending.

Budgeting also serves as a tool for self-discipline, helping individuals to avoid overspending and to stay within their financial means. It enables individuals to set realistic spending limits based on their income levels and financial obligations, ultimately promoting better financial health and stability.

This role of budgeting supports financial goals, such as saving for retirement, paying off debt, or planning for significant life events, making it an essential aspect of personal finance management.
